Jonathan Gould is currently a partner at the law firm Jones Day. He previously served as chief legal officer at Bitfury and was senior deputy comptroller and chief counsel at the OCC from late 2018 to mid-2021. Before that, he was a director at BlackRock from 2014 to 2018
